A learning and development manager builds training programs for employees within a business or organization. This training focuses on helping employees understand and work towards the organization’s goals. A learning and development manager may also work with the training and development staff to create instructional videos, schedule and develop in-class lectures, and create online learning environments.
| Aspect | Learning And Development Manager | Training Coordinator |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Bachelor's degree, often certifications in L&D or HR | High school diploma or equivalent, some roles prefer certifications |
| Work Environment | Strategic planning, overseeing programs, management | Organizing and delivering training sessions, administrative tasks |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Corporate, educational, nonprofit sectors | Corporate, healthcare, retail sectors |
The Learning And Development Manager focuses on designing, implementing, and overseeing training strategies at a strategic level, while the Training Coordinator handles the logistics and delivery of training sessions. Both roles require strong communication skills, but the manager's role is more strategic and managerial, whereas the coordinator's role is more operational and execution-focused.

Morningside University is accepting applications for the position of Director of Experiential Learning. The Director of Experiential Learning provides leadership, coordination, and strategic support for employer-engaged learning opportunities within professionally-focused programs such as Agriculture, Aviation, Business, and Computer Science. The Director develops and maintains relationships with employers, industry leaders, alumni, and community partners to create meaningful experiential learning opportunities that enhance student success, career readiness, and workforce development.
The Director serves as the primary liaison between the University and employer partners and works collaboratively with faculty, staff, Career Services, Admissions, and Advancement to ensure that internships, externships, job shadowing experiences, undergraduate research opportunities, industry projects, and employment pathways align with academic programs and institutional goals.
Duties and Responsibilities:
Employer Partnership Development
• Develop and implement employer engagement strategies that support professionally focused programs such as Agriculture, Aviation, Business, and Computer Science.
• Identify, cultivate, and maintain relationships with local, regional, and national employers, industry organizations, alumni, and community partners.
• Serve as the primary point of contact for employer relations within the assigned academic units.
• Expand employer participation in internships, externships, job shadowing, mentorships, applied learning projects, undergraduate research opportunities, and graduate employment pathways.
• Coordinate employer visits, networking events, industry advisory board engagement, guest speakers, and site visits.
Experiential Learning Coordination
• Coordinate internship, externship, job shadowing, and other experiential learning opportunities for students.
• Assist students in preparing for, securing, and successfully completing experiential learning experiences.
• Collaborate with faculty to ensure experiential learning opportunities align with program outcomes and accreditation requirements where applicable.
• Support the development, implementation, and assessment of experiential learning experiences across multiple disciplines.
• Coordinate communication among students, faculty supervisors, and employer partners throughout experiential learning placements.
Student Career and Professional Development
• Collaborate with Career Services and faculty to support student career readiness initiatives.
• Assist students in connecting classroom learning to career pathways through experiential learning opportunities.
• Support student participation in employer engagement events, networking activities, career fairs, and professional development programs.
• Promote experiential learning opportunities to prospective and current students.
Recruitment and External Relations
• Collaborate with Admissions and academic leadership to communicate the value of experiential learning opportunities to prospective students and families.
• Represent the University at industry events, professional meetings, recruitment functions, and community outreach activities.
• Assist academic programs in building partnerships that support enrollment growth and student success.
Assessment, Reporting, and Continuous Improvement
• Collect, analyze, and report data related to internships, externships, employer engagement, student participation, and employment outcomes.
• Administer employer and student satisfaction surveys and utilize results for continuous improvement.
• Prepare annual reports and recommendations related to experiential learning effectiveness and workforce engagement.
• Assist academic leadership with institutional effectiveness initiatives and strategic planning.
University Service
• Collaborate with faculty, staff, Career Services, Admissions, Advancement, and other campus partners to advance institutional goals.
• Participate in university committees, meetings, and professional development activities as assigned.
• Work with Admissions, faculty, and staff to attract and retain students at Morningside University.
• Work to increase awareness and advance the reputation of Morningside University's academic programs.
Required Qualifications
Master's degree in business, education, agriculture, aviation, communications, human resources, higher education administration, organizational leadership, computer sciences, or a related discipline.
Demonstrate the ability to work independently and collaboratively as a member of a team with minimal supervision.
Communicate effectively through strong written and oral communication skills.
Demonstrate strong organizational, interpersonal, and time-management skills.
Manage multiple priorities and projects simultaneously while meeting deadlines.
Build productive relationships with students, faculty, staff, alumni, employers, and community stakeholders.
Able to utilize data to inform decision-making and continuous improvement
Possess a valid driver's license and the ability to travel as required.
Demonstrate willingness to work occasional evenings and weekends.
Preferred Qualifications
PhD in business, education, agriculture, aviation, communications, human resources, higher education administration, organizational leadership, computer sciences, or a related discipline.
Possess three or more years of professional experience in employer relations, career services, workforce development, recruitment, sales, business development, higher education, or a related field.
Demonstrate experience in sales, business development, employer engagement, relationship management, or stakeholder development.
Ability to develop and maintain partnerships with employers, industry organizations, alumni, and community stakeholders.
Coordinate internships, externships, experiential learning programs, workforce development initiatives, or career-related programming.
Demonstrate experience working in higher education, career services, talent acquisition, economic development, or a related field.

About the School of Agriculture & Aviation
The School of Agriculture & Aviation has experienced significant growth in recent years and offers majors in Applied Agriculture & Food Studies, Agribusiness, Agricultural Education, Professional Flight, and Aviation Management, along with specialized programs and minors in Agribusiness, Animal Science, Agronomy, Agricultural Communications, Food Safety, Environmental Policy & Law, and Uncrewed Aircraft Systems (Drone Technology). The School maintains a 99% placement rate for graduates and provides students with extensive experiential learning opportunities through internships, externships, undergraduate research, flight training, student-managed enterprises, and industry partnerships. As part of the curriculum, every Agriculture student completes a required experiential learning experience through an extended externship, internship, undergraduate research project, or other approved applied learning opportunity that connects classroom learning with professional practice. This longstanding commitment to experiential learning has served as a model for expanding employer-engaged learning opportunities across other academic programs at Morningside University.
About the School of Business
The School of Business has grown more than 60% in the past several years and offers majors in Business Administration, Finance, Management, Marketing, Managerial Accounting, and Public Accounting. The School maintains a 99% placement rate for graduates and is experiencing growth across all of its majors. The School is anticipating groundbreaking for a new state-of-the-art School of Business building in 2026. The School of Business also offers an innovative, rapidly growing online MBA program with specializations in areas such as Artificial Intelligence, Cybersecurity, Business Analytics, Finance, and Healthcare Administration. The School is staffed by 10 faculty members, most of whom bring extensive private- and public-sector experience to the classroom. The School also serves as a local and regional resource to business organizations.
About Morningside University
Morningside University is a private university located in Sioux City, Iowa, serving more than 2,000 students from nearly all 50 states and more than 30 countries. Established in 1894 by The United Methodist Church, Morningside continues to maintain its historic affiliation with the Church while preparing students for lifelong personal and professional success. Chad Benson serves as President of the University.
The University's main campus encompasses 69 acres in a scenic, park-like setting in the heart of Iowa's fourth-largest city. Additional educational facilities include Lags Farm and Sioux Gateway Airport, which serve as experiential learning extensions of the School of Agriculture & Aviation.
The School of Business and Department of Computer Sciences maintain strong partnerships with regional, national, and global employers, providing students with extensive opportunities for internships, applied learning, undergraduate research, and career placement.
Morningside's largest undergraduate programs include education, nursing, and business. In addition, the Sharon Walker School of Education, Nylen School of Nursing, and School of Business offer well-established online undergraduate completion, graduate, and post-baccalaureate programs that serve traditional, nontraditional, and professional learners.
A strong commitment to experiential learning, personalized instruction, and career preparation has enabled Morningside University to maintain an exceptional 99% placement rate in employment or graduate school for undergraduate graduates over the past decade.
Morningside University is home to the Mustangs Athletic Department, which sponsors 28 varsity sports and proudly competes in the National Association of Intercollegiate Athletics (NAIA) as a member of the Great Plains Athletic Conference (GPAC). Students may also participate in more than 50 student-led clubs and organizations or engage in music, theatre, and artistic opportunities through the School of Visual and Performing Arts regardless of their academic major.
